Gameplay
The stickman arcade title drops enemy stickmen onto different platform positions, forcing you to read height, distance, and attack timing at once. A target above you needs a higher release, while a close enemy often demands a flatter throw. Wait too long, and their own weapon leaves the platform first. That near-miss feeling is the whole hook: your spear passes their head, then theirs hits you.
Advanced aiming strategy starts with the head when the angle is open. If the enemy stands far away, aim slightly above the head so the spear falls into place. When platforms are uneven, watch the arc rather than the body, because gravity can pull a good-looking shot under the target. How to Play
Drag to aim, release to throw, and reset your angle before the next stickman warrior lines up a shot. The most common beginner mistake is aiming straight at the torso from every distance. That works until the platform changes height, then the spear drops short and the round ends. Aim ahead of the danger, not after it has settled.
Another mistake is holding the shot while trying to make it look exact. In this fast-paced throwing game, hesitation gives enemies time to find their rhythm. Release before they settle into their attack motion, especially when they spawn close. Clearing two or three enemies in one smooth rhythm feels sharp because any pause can break the run.
Controls
Desktop aiming gives you a steady drag path, while mobile play feels quicker and more direct with a thumb. Both control styles reward small adjustments. Pull too far, and the spear sails over the target.
- Mouse drag — Aim the spear and set the throw angle
- Mouse release — Throw the spear
- Touch drag — Aim on mobile screens
- Lift finger — Release the spear
